What Is ROI in Digital Marketing?
Return on Investment (ROI) in digital marketing refers to the ratio between the net profit from marketing activities and the cost of those activities. By leveraging AI analytics tools, businesses can gather and analyze performance metrics that provide deeper insights into customer behaviors and campaign effectiveness.

Common Mistakes in AI-Driven ROI Tracking
Despite the evident advantages, many businesses make critical errors when integrating AI-driven ROI tracking into their strategies. Understanding these pitfalls can save both time and resources.
Overlooking Data Quality
One significant mistake is neglecting the quality of data being fed into AI systems. Poor-quality data can lead to inaccurate insights and misguided marketing efforts. Ensure that your data is clean, relevant, and accurate before analysis.
Ignoring Human Insights
While AI offers robust data analysis capabilities, it should complement, not replace, human judgment. Marketers must interpret AI-generated insights and contextualize them within broader market trends to make informed decisions.

Measuring the True Impact of AI-Driven Metrics
Understanding the real influence of AI on your ROI is crucial. Here’s what you should measure:
-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C): Evaluate the total costs associated with acquiring a new customer through various digital channels.
- Conversion Rates: Track the percentage of visitors who complete desired actions, providing insight into overall campaign effectiveness.
- Lifetime Value (LTV): Calculate the total revenue expected from a customer over their entire relationship with your brand. This metric is vital for long-term planning.
